About Kojo

It's time to build. Whether it's creating more housing, upgrading our infrastructure, or adapting to climate change, one thing is clear: the construction industry is at the center of solving our biggest problems. We’re making buildings cheaper and easier to build by transforming the way commercial construction companies buy their materials. Join us.

Founded in 2018, Kojo is now one of the fastest-growing construction technology companies in the world. Construction accounts for $10 trillion in global spend annually and we can’t live without its output - our roads, schools, hospitals, and offices. Despite this, there’s been very little innovation over the past 70 years in how materials - which constitute up to 40% of project costs - are bought and sold. This is our opportunity.

About the Role

We are seeking a highly motivated and detail-oriented Accounting Manager to join our dynamic finance team. This role is ideal for someone with strong technical accounting skills and hands-on experience in managing day-to-day financial operations, including payroll. You will be responsible for ensuring the accurate and timely processing of financial transactions, overseeing payroll, and supporting the company’s financial reporting and compliance efforts.

As the Accounting Manager at Kojo Technologies, you will play a critical role in maintaining the company’s financial integrity, ensuring compliance with accounting standards and payroll regulations, and providing accurate financial data to senior management for strategic decision-making.

Key Responsibilities

  • Oversee and manage the day-to-day accounting operations, including accounts payable, accounts receivable, invoicing, general ledger, and payroll.

  • Ensure accurate and timely processing of payroll for all employees and contractors, including calculating wages, deductions, bonuses, and benefits, while ensuring compliance with all federal, state, and local payroll tax regulations.

  • Assist with monthly close process helping to prepare accurate and timely monthly, quarterly, and annual financial statements in accordance with GAAP (Generally Accepted Accounting Principles).

  • Reconcile accounts, including payroll-related accounts, tax liabilities, employee benefits, and deductions.

  • Maintain up-to-date payroll records for all employees, ensuring compliance with applicable labor laws and tax regulations.

  • Complete monthly sales tax reconciliation and oversee sales tax return filing by Avalara.

  • Oversee invoice collections to ensure customers pay their invoices in a timely manner.

  • Provide financial reports to senior management as needed.

  • Work closely with external auditors during the annual audit process to ensure the accuracy of payroll, tax filings, and related financial data.

  • Ensure compliance with federal, state, and local financial regulations, tax filings, and employment laws, including regular payroll tax filings and reports.

  • Identify and implement process improvements to enhance efficiency, accuracy, and compliance within the accounting and payroll functions.

  • Assist in special projects as needed, such as system upgrades, automation initiatives, and process optimization.

About You

  •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, or a related field; CPA or CMA designation preferred.

  • 5+ years of progressive experience in accounting, including payroll management experience.

  • Experience with US payroll processing, including a thorough understanding of US federal, state, and local payroll tax regulations and filings. International applicants must have experience managing US payroll compliance and tax filings for US-based employees.

  • Strong knowledge of GAAP, financial reporting, payroll processing, and regulatory compliance.

  • Proficiency in accounting and payroll software (e.g., Xero, QuickBooks, NetSuite, Rippling, or similar) and Microsoft Excel. Experience with Rippling ideal.

  • Excellent analytical, problem-solving, and organizational skills.

  • Strong communication skills, both written and verbal, with the ability to collaborate effectively with all levels of the organization.

  • Detail-oriented with a high level of accuracy and ability to work under pressure and meet deadlines.

  • Ability to adapt to a fast-paced, growing environment with a proactive mindset.

  • Experience in international payroll including Canada and LatAm is a plus but not required.
